Netanyahu's Video Response to Death Rumors
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u recently addressed rumors of his death by releasing a video. This video served as a direct response to misinformation circulating about his demise. In the video, Netanyahu prominently displayed his hand, showing five fingers, as a symbolic gesture to affirm his vitality and authenticity.
The AI Connection: Six-Finger Flaw
The incident draws attention to a known issue with generative artificial intelligence (AI) technologies, which sometimes inaccurately depict human hands with six fingers. This flaw has been acknowledged by tech giants, including Google, which admitted to significant errors in AI-generated imagery.
